R. "De Etta" Kroenlein, 84, of Effingham, Illinois passed away at 1:29 A.M. Wednesday, March 13, 2019, at her daughter's residence in rural Effingham, Illinois.

She was born June 11, 1934, in Douglas County, Illinois, the daughter of Leonard E. and Gladys Irene (Clark) Weber. De Etta married James Zike in November, 1951; he passed away March 10, 1957; she later married Donald Reed. Mr. Reed passed away October 7, 1977. She later married Kenneth E. "Skinner" Kroenlein December 1, 1979 in Mattoon, Illinois, Skinner passed away April 17, 2003. De Etta worked at Central National Bank of Mattoon, Illinois for over thirty years and for Comer Nissan / K.C. Summers in Mattoon, Illinois. She was a member of the First Baptist Church and the Eastern Star Lodge both of Mattoon, Illinois.

De Etta leaves her daughter, Susie Bowlin (Richard) of Effingham, Illinois and Linda Gamble (Scott) of Mahomet, Illinois; step-son, Gary Kroenlein (Hazel) of Mattoon, Illinois; three grandchildren and 2 great-gr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by her parents, three husbands James Zike, Donald Reed and Kenneth Kroenlein; three brothers, Darrell, Jim and Claude Weber and one step daughter, Sandra K. Hopper.
